Pierwszy program, jaki istnieje uczy się kodować Hello World Program w Javie. Jednak wiele razy pomijamy podstawową składnię. Za pośrednictwem tego artykułu przejdę do szczegółów programu Hello World w Javie.
Poniżej znajdują się tematy poruszone w tym artykule:
Zacznijmy.
Hello World Program w Javie
Zanim przejdziemy do szczegółów, zacznijmy od kodowania i zobaczmy, jak działa podstawowy program Hello World jest zakodowany.
public class HelloWorldDemo {public static void main (String [] args) {System.out.println ('Hello World!') System.exit (0) // sukces}}
Skoro skończyłeś już kodowanie, przeanalizujmy teraz dogłębnie składnię programu.
Analiza składni
Wiersz 1: klasa publiczna HelloWorldDemo {
W tej linii używane jest słowo kluczowe klasa do deklarowania nowej klasy o nazwie HelloWorldDemo. Ponieważ Java to Język, cała definicja klasy, w tym wszystkie jej elementy członkowskie, musi znajdować się między otwierającym nawiasem klamrowym {a zamykającym nawiasem klamrowym}. Ponadto używa słowa kluczowego public, aby określić dostępność klasy spoza pakietu.
Linia 2: public static void main (String [] args) {
Ta linia deklaruje metodę o nazwie main (String []).Nazywa się Główny i działa jako punkt wejścia dla Kompilator Java aby rozpocząć wykonywanie programu. Innymi słowy, za każdym razem, gdy jakikolwiek program jest wykonywany w Javie, główna metoda jest pierwszą wywoływaną funkcją. Inne funkcje aplikacji są następnie wywoływane z metody głównej. W standardowej aplikacji Java do wyzwolenia wykonania wymagana jest jedna główna metoda.
wyskakujący komunikat skryptu java
Przełammy teraz cały wiersz i przeanalizujmy każde słowo:
publiczny : to jestmodyfikator dostępu określa widoczność. Pozwala JVM na wykonanie metody z dowolnego miejsca.
statyczny : Jest to słowo kluczowe, które pomaga w uczynieniu dowolnego elementu klasy statycznego. Główna metoda jest statyczna, ponieważ nie ma potrzeby tworzenia obiektu do wywołania w Javie. W ten sposób JVM może go wywołać bez konieczności tworzenia obiektu, który pomaga w oszczędzaniu pamięci.
unieważnić : Reprezentuje zwracany typ metody. Ponieważ główna metoda Java nie zwraca żadnej wartości, jej zwracany typ jest deklarowany jako void.
Główny() : Jest to nazwa metody skonfigurowanej w maszynie JVM.
Strunowy[] : Oznacza to, że główna metoda Java może akceptować pojedynczy argument linii tego typu . Jest to również znane jako argumenty wiersza poleceń Java. Poniżej wymieniłem kilka prawidłowych podpisów głównych metod Java:
- public static void main (String [] args)
- public static void main (String [] args)
- public static void main (String args [])
- public static void main (String… args)
- static public void main (String [] args)
- public static final void main (String [] args)
- final public static void main (String [] args)
Wiersz 3: System.out.println („Witaj świecie!”)
System : Jest to wstępnie zdefiniowana klasa w pakiecie java.lang, która zawiera różne przydatne metody i zmienne.
na zewnątrz : Jest to statyczne pole składowe typu PrintStream.
println: Jest to metoda klasy PrintStreami służy do drukowania argumentu, który został przekazany do standardowej konsoli i nowej linii. Możesz także użyć metody print () zamiast println ().
Wiersz 4: System.exit (0)
Plik java.lang. System . Wyjście () jest używana dowyjdź zbieżący program poprzez zakończenie aktualnie wykonywanej Wirtualnej Maszyny Javy. Ta metoda przyjmuje kod stanu jako dane wejściowe, co zwykle jestwartość niezerowa. Wskazuje na wypadek nieprawidłowego zakończenia.
- wyjście (0): Służy do wskazania pomyślnego zakończenia.
- exit (1) lubexit (-1) lub dowolna wartość niezerowa: Służy do wskazania nieudanego zakończenia.
Więc to wszystko dotyczyło składni programu. Zobaczmy teraz, jak skompilować Hello World w programie Java.
Kompilowanie programu
Teraz musisz wpisać ten program w edytorze tekstu i zapisać go z nazwą klasy, której użyłeś w swoim programie. W moim przypadku zapiszę go jako HelloWorldDemo.java.
Następnym krokiem jest przejście do okna konsoli i przejście do katalogu, w którym zapisałeś swój program.
Teraz żeby skompilować program wpisz poniższe polecenie:
javac HelloWorldDemo.java
Uwaga: Java rozróżnia wielkość liter, dlatego upewnij się, że wpisujesz nazwę pliku w odpowiednim formacie.
co to jest char w java
Po pomyślnym wykonaniu polecenie to wygeneruje plik HelloWorldDemo.class, który będzie niezależny od komputera i przenośny.
Teraz, gdy pomyślnie skompilowałeś program, spróbujmy wykonać nasz program Hello World w Javie i uzyskać wynik.
Wykonanie programu
Aby uruchomić HelloWorld w w linii poleceń wystarczy wpisać poniższy kod:
java HelloWorldDemo
Voila! Z powodzeniem wykonałeś swój pierwszy program w Javie.
Jeśli używasz IDE, możesz pominąć ten problem i po prostu nacisnąć przycisk wykonania w swoim IDE, aby skompilować i uruchomić Hello World w programie Java.
To prowadzi nas do końca tego artykułuHello World Program w Javie. Jeśli chcesz dowiedzieć się więcej o Javie, możesz skorzystać z naszego .
Teraz, gdy zrozumiałeś, co to jestHello World Program w Javie, Sprawdź autorstwa Edureka, zaufanej firmy zajmującej się edukacją online, z siecią ponad 250 000 zadowolonych uczniów rozsianych po całym świecie. Szkolenie i certyfikacja J2EE i SOA firmy Edureka jest przeznaczony dla studentów i profesjonalistów, którzy chcą zostać programistami Java. Kurs ma na celu zapewnienie przewagi w programowaniu w języku Java i przeszkolenie zarówno podstawowych, jak i zaawansowanych koncepcji języka Java, a także różnych struktur Java, takich jak Hibernate i Spring.
Masz do nas pytanie? Proszę wspomnieć o tym w sekcji komentarzy tego „Hello World Program w Javie”, A my skontaktujemy się z Tobą tak szybko, jak to możliwe.